Rats were treated with toxicological equivalent doses of TCDD (100ng/kg), PeCDF (200ng/kg), PCB126 (1000ng/kg) and PCB153 (1000ug/kg) 5 days a week for 13 weeks. Experiment Overall Design: There are 6 control chips and representing animals treated with vehicle control. There are 3 biological replicates (3 chips) for each treatment group (eg. TCDD, PCB126), each biological replicate is derived from 2 individual animals. A total of 21 chips were analyzed. Intensities were normalized using the GC-Robust Multiarray (GCRMA) method through Genetraffic software package.</item><item key="source">http://www.ebi.ac.uk/arrayexpress/experiments/E-GEOD-5789</item><item key="sample_source">http://www.ebi.ac.uk/arrayexpress/experiments/E-GEOD-5789/samples/</item></data></biogps>
